Hi All, I seem to have a small amount of fluid which I assume is oil leaking from the 4 small holes at the front of the engine. These holes are located just under the fins at the front under the cylinder head. I'll upload a photo.
The bike is a 2015 model storm bought brand new in 2016 and now has 90000 kms on it.
Any ideas? Thanks Dave

These are the drain holes for the spark plug holes. If oil is present it could mean a leaking cam cover seal. It can also happen after a major service when the cover is removed. Clean off the oil and monitor for continuing leakage, if so reseat the cam cover seal.
